Every day, seven young people aged between 13-24 hear them words “you have cancer” They will each need specialised nursing care and support to get them through it. Teenage Cancer Trust are the only UK charity dedicated to meeting this vital need – so no young person has to face cancer alone.
Teenage Cancer Trust offers unique care and support, designed for and with young people. We fund specialised nurses, youth workersand hospital units in the NHS, so young people have dedicated staff and facilities to support them throughout treatment.
They also run events for young people with cancer to help them regain independence and meet other young people going through something similar.
